What the record shows
A 5-room here sold for $650,000 in Jul 2026. The same flat type in this block averaged $460,538 in 2020 - a gain of $189,462 - about $87 a day while the owner slept.
In this block, 5-room flats from floor 9 up have sold for a median of $675,000 - $55,000 more than floors 4 and below, same flat type, same block.
This block crosses 60 years remaining in 2036 - the line where CPF usage rules begin tightening for buyers. In Woodlands over the last two years, flats below that line sold at a median 10% below their younger neighbours' PSF (467 sales).
A executive on Woodlands Cres has already fetched $880,000 - 88% of the way to a million-dollar flat.
Across Woodlands, roughly 2,047 flats in newly-completed blocks reach the end of MOP between 2026 and 2028 - new sellers entering this market.
